4 Ports and LEDs
Ports
Console port
The switch provides a serial console port and a mini USB console port.
Table4-1 Console port specifications
|
Item |
Description |
|
Connector type |
· Serial console port: RJ-45 · Mini USB console port: USB mini-Type B |
|
Compliant standard |
· Serial console port: EIA/TIA-232 · Mini USB console port: USB 2.0 |
|
Transmission baud rate |
9600 bps (default) to 115200 bps |
|
Services |
· Serial console port: ¡ Provides connection to an ASCII terminal. ¡ Provides connection to the serial port of a local or remote terminal running terminal emulation program. · Mini USB console port: ¡ Provides connection to an ASCII terminal. ¡ Provides connection to the USB port of a local terminal running terminal emulation program. |
Management Ethernet port
The switch provides a copper management Ethernet port and a fiber management Ethernet port. You can connect these ports to a PC or management station for loading and debugging software or remote management.
Table4-2 Copper management Ethernet port specifications
|
Item |
Specification |
|
Connector type |
RJ-45 |
|
Connector quantity |
1 |
|
Port transmission rate |
10/100/1000 Mbps, half/full duplex |
|
Transmission medium and max transmission distance |
100 m (328.08 ft) over category 5 twisted pair cable |
|
Functions and services |
Switch software and Boot ROM upgrade, network management |

USB port
The switch has one OHC-compliant USB2.0 port that can upload and download data at a rate up to 480 Mbps. You can use this USB port to access the file system on the flash of the switch, for example, to upload or download application and configuration files.
|
|
NOTE: USB devices from different vendors vary in compatibilities and drivers. H3C does not guarantee the correct operation of USB devices from all vendors on the switch. If a USB device fails to operate on the switch, replace it with one from another vendor. |

LEDs
System status LED
The system status LED shows the operating state of the switch.
Table4-4 System status LED description
|
LED mark |
Status |
Description |
|
SYS |
Steady green |
The switch is operating correctly. |
|
Flashing green |
The switch is performing power-on self test (POST). |
|
|
Steady red |
The switch has failed the POST or is faulty. |
|
|
Flashing red |
Some ports have failed the POST and cannot operate correctly. |
|
|
Off |
The switch is powered off or has failed to start up. |

Power supply status LED
Table4-10 Power supply status LED description
|
Status |
Description |
|
Steady green |
The power supply is operating correctly. |
|
Flashing green |
The power supply has normal power input but is not installed in the switch. |
|
Steady red |
The power supply has failed or has entered a protection state. |
|
Alternating between red and green |
An alarm has occurred when one of the following conditions exists on the power supply but the power supply does not enter protection state: · Output overcurrent. · Output power overload. · Overtemperature. |
|
Flashing red |
· The power supply does not have power input. If the switch has two power supplies, one with power input but the other without, the LED on the power supply without power input flashes red. · The power supply is in input undervoltage protection state. |
|
Off |
The power supply does not have power input. |

5 Cooling system
|
CAUTION: · To guarantee heat dissipation, you must install fan trays of the same model on the switch. · If a fan tray is in one of the following conditions, the other fan trays will operate at the maximum speed to ensure adequate heat dissipation of the switch: ¡ The fan tray is in absent or fault status. ¡ The fan tray has a different airflow direction than the other fan trays. ¡ The fan tray is just inserted. |
To dissipate heat timely and ensure system stability, the switch uses high-performance front-rear air aisle cooling system. Consider the site ventilation design when you plan the installation site for the switch.
Table5-1 Fan tray options for the switch
|
Available fan trays |
Airflow direction |
|
LSPM1FANSA |
From the power supply side to the port side |
|
LSPM1FANSB |
From the port side to the power supply side |
